An excerpt from the blog:

*To advance disaster resilience and mitigation efforts, government and
private-sector organizations are developing innovative financing mechanisms
that reduce consumer costs and incentivize pre-disaster mitigation
activities.  That’s why, today, the White House hosted a Forum on Smart
Finance for Disaster Resilience to highlight innovations in disaster
mitigation and resilience finance, including emerging public-private
collaborations with banking, insurance, and financial services sectors.
These financial innovations are empowering communities across the country
to mitigate against the current and future impacts of climate change,
including wildfire, drought, extreme storms, and hurricanes.  *
